The NASCAR Hall of Fame presents the third in a series of summer movie presentations, “Ice Age."
Shown on the facility’s exterior 28-foot-wide Panasonic LED board, the film is set against the onslaught of the ice age - and a world filled with wonder and danger - the story revolves around three unforgettable characters: a woolly mammoth, a saber-toothed tiger, and a sloth, who unite to return a human baby to his tribe.
“Ice Age” is a digitally-animated feature film from Blue Sky Studios, a top computer graphics imagery/feature film animation studio and a division of Twentieth Century Fox Animation Studios.
